Feb 8th, 2023 | Category: The Gleaner Minute | 1:56#jamaicagleaner #jamaica #decarteretcollege #spellingbee #taevionmorgan #childrensown#alwaynehill #police #charged #assault #crime #stann #eu #syria #turkey #earthquake #nba #lebronjames #kareemabduljabbar FEBURARY 8, 2023: Taevion Morgan from DeCarteret College in Manchester won The Gleaner 2023 Children's Own Spelling Bee title during the national finals on Wednesday... Constable Alwayne Hill, one of four policemen implicated in the alleged sexual assault and robbery of a female motorist in January has been charged with rape, corruptly solicit and grievous sexual assault…Two men were shot and killed in separate incidents in St Ann between Tuesday night and Wednesday morning...OVERSEAS: The European Union (EU) has announced plans to host a donors conference next month to marshal international aid for Syria and Turkey following this week's catastrophic earthquake…IN SPORTS:
